From 4c9d5ef55883fd94094371813f80cfef0befcf74 Mon Sep 17 00:00:00 2001 From: "Johan B. C. Engelen" Date: Thu, 11 Sep 2008 21:44:48 +0000 Subject: convert almost all libnrtype to Geom:: (bzr r6793) --- src/gradient-chemistry.cpp |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'src/gradient-chemistry.cpp') diff --git a/src/gradient-chemistry.cpp b/src/gradient-chemistry.cpp index afbf16009..26945def6 100644 --- a/src/gradient-chemistry.cpp +++ b/src/gradient-chemistry.cpp @@ -31,6 +31,9 @@ #include "sp-tspan.h" #include #include +#include +#include +#include <2geom/transforms.h> #include "xml/repr.h" #include "svg/svg.h" #include "svg/svg-color.h" @@ -299,9 +302,9 @@ sp_gradient_reset_to_userspace (SPGradient *gr, SPItem *item) sp_repr_set_svg_double(repr, "r", width/2); // we want it to be elliptic, not circular - NR::Matrix squeeze = NR::Matrix (NR::translate (-center)) * - NR::Matrix (NR::scale(1, height/width)) * - NR::Matrix (NR::translate (center)); + Geom::Matrix squeeze = Geom::Translate (-center) * + Geom::Scale(1, height/width) * + Geom::Translate (center); gr->gradientTransform = squeeze; { -- cgit v1.2.3